2009-11-25 6 views
5

Heyho, Estoy buscando una herramienta como JDepender para dibujar un gráfico para un archivo de clase java. JDepende de las costuras para estar bien, pero no está resolviendo los deps de los deps (tal vez solo me faltan algunas opciones especiales). Sería bueno tener una salida directa en formato .dot o una imagen. Graciasdibujar un gráfico de dependencia para una clase java

Respuesta

2

Puede considerar UMLGraphDoc. Lo he usado, y lo encontré bastante útil.

Dibujará diagramas basados ​​en las relaciones que se deducen automáticamente, o que se especificaron mediante etiquetas especiales javadoc.

+0

Sí, pero utiliza éste archivos fuente de Java (javadoc) en lugar de archivos de clase (no es que lo que el PO está buscando?) –

+0

derecho, tengo los archivos de clase (consiguió las fuentes también, pero es 13kloc escrito en 48 horas por 2.5 personas, por lo que no hay nada que pueda llamar documentación). Entonces, una solución que trabaje con los archivos de clase es la mejor manera. –

+0

@Andreas_D: Sí, UMLGraphDoc se ejecuta en los archivos de origen. Sin embargo, no necesita javadocs. Si están allí, los usará, pero también puede hacer diagramas basados ​​en jerarquías de tipos, etc. – sleske

1

No está seguro de lo que entendemos por dependencias de las dependencias, y ciertamente no hay .dot, pero intenta Fractalidad aquí:

http://www.edmundkirwan.com/pub/index.html

+0

.dot formato significa DOT Idioma (http://en.wikipedia.org/wiki/DOT_idioma) notación en archivo de texto que puede ser utilizado con, por ejemplo. GraphViz para generar todo tipo de gráficos. – Esko

3

Usted puede intentar JavaDepend, da muchas características para las necesidades de dependencia.

enter image description here

Cuestiones relacionadas